In-Home vs Center-Based: Finding the Right Fit for Your Dodge County Family

The choice between in-home and center-based ABA therapy depends on your child’s learning preferences, your family’s farming schedule, and how you want to integrate therapy with Dodge County’s agricultural lifestyle and community traditions.

 

Center-based therapy at our La Vista facility provides structured learning environments with specialized resources, facilitated peer interactions, and intensive programming that many rural families find beneficial for skill development. While the 45-minute commute from Fremont requires planning around farming schedules, many families appreciate the dedicated therapeutic environment and peer learning opportunities.

 

In-home therapy offers the advantage of skill development within natural farm and family settings while eliminating travel time and accommodating the demanding schedules common among agricultural families. This approach works particularly well for families managing seasonal farm work, those with multiple children, or children who benefit from extensive practice with daily farm routines and rural community integration.

 

Our BCBAs work closely with Dodge County families to determine the optimal service combination based on individual needs, insurance coverage, and practical considerations including seasonal farming demands, travel logistics, and family dynamics unique to rural communities.

What’s the Best ABA Therapy Option for Dodge County Families?

Every Dodge County family has unique circumstances, and the most effective ABA therapy approach depends on multiple factors including your child’s learning style, your family’s agricultural schedule, and your rural community involvement preferences.

Some children thrive in the structured, resource-rich environment of our La Vista center, benefiting from peer interactions and specialized equipment not available in rural home settings. The center environment provides intensive learning opportunities and systematic structure that can accelerate skill development and school preparation for rural students.

Other children demonstrate optimal progress within familiar farm and home environments where they can immediately practice newly acquired skills in authentic agricultural and daily contexts. In-home therapy proves particularly effective for addressing functional life skills, farm routine integration, and community participation within your specific Dodge County agricultural operation.

Many Dodge County families achieve the best therapeutic outcomes through a strategic combination approach, utilizing center-based therapy for intensive skill building and structured socialization while supplementing with in-home sessions that target practical application and rural community integration. Our BCBAs work with each family to develop the most effective service plan based on individual needs and agricultural lifestyle considerations.
